Stumpel In today?s world, sustainability is reshaping the business paradigm projects are contributing to. And project managers need to be ready for this in order to deliver successful projects.The development towards sustainability requires a 'systems change' that impacts organizations at all levels. As projects shape the future, they play an instrumental role in realizing these changes. In this context, the traditional task-oriented nature of project management, with a narrow focus on delivering the agreed project output, does not suffice anymore. Managing projects in organizations with increasing ESG commitments requires an alignment of projects with the sustainability strategy, goals and standards of the sponsoring and participating organizations, that goes beyond the traditional scope of consideration of project management. As project management evolves in this context of ESG commitments towards Sustainable Project Management, so will project managers need to do.It is not anymore about ?green? projects, or about considering ?green? in project management: Sustainable project management represents a scope, paradigm and mind shift in project management, and requires specific competences of project professionals. This Reference Guide provides the integration of sustainability competences into the competence baseline defined in IPMA ICB4. The guide identifies 92 Key Competence Indicators that are crucial for project professionals to succeed in projects, today and tomorrow.
